Verse (16:34), Word 2 - Quranic Grammar

__

The second word of verse (16:34) is a feminine noun and is in the nominative case (مرفوع). The noun's triliteral root is sīn wāw hamza (س و أ).

Chapter (16) sūrat l-naḥl (The Bees)


(16:34:2)
sayyiātu
(the) evil (results)
N – nominative feminine noun اسم مرفوع

Verse (16:34)

The analysis above refers to the 34th verse of chapter 16 (sūrat l-naḥl):

Sahih International: So they were struck by the evil consequences of what they did and were enveloped by what they used to ridicule.
